AMERICAN ENGINEERING TESTING INC is Hiring a Project Manager II (Civil Engineering) Near Fargo, ND

Job Summary

The Project Manager is responsible and accountable for planning and allocating resources, preparing budgets, monitoring progress, and keeping stakeholders informed throughout the project lifecycle. The Project Manager leads a team of professionals in completing projects by a set deadline to uphold business initiatives. This position defines, plans, and delivers complex programs that require cross-functional collaboration and management of inter-dependencies between a group of projects and/or related activities within the constraint of scope, quality, time and budget. Includes the management of a group of internal and/or matrixed employees and contractors that serve on the program(s) to deliver solutions for the business. All of this takes place within the framework of achieving the company's goals and vision.

Essential Functions

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Manage large-scope and/or high-risk projects from proposal to completion.
  • Effectively manage mult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Lead inter-office and/or inter-department project teams.
  • Determine cost structure, adjust fee schedules, and provide estimates for work.
  • Review, draft, and negotiate AET sub-consultant contracts in accordance with company policy.
  • Read, understand, and comply with all project contractual requirements.
  • Ensure that all projects have necessary documentation completed, including written proposals, contracts, and Acknowledgement of Services, signed or documented as indicated by company policy.
  • Open work orders, prepare change orders, and complete other necessary documentation in Dynamics.
  • Manage project financial status including adjustments.
  • Monitor project budget monthly (at a minimum) and prepare monthly invoices for review.
  • Review aged accounts and work with AET accounting department to arrange payment on aged accounts.
  • Maintain project file including contract, reports, invoicing, and other project documentation.
  • Maintain client communication for the project, including any changes to project services or budget.
  • Actively communicate project risks and concerns to stakeholders.
  • Provide routine project progress updates.
  • Develop and maintain business relationships.
  • Actively market AET services to new and existing business contacts.
  • Actively participate in professional organizations.
  • Assist in the development and implementation of strategic growth plans for department.
  • As applicable, provide engineering or technical expertise for assigned projects. Technical role will vary according to level of technical expertise and experience.
  • Coordinate with other AET staff with the ultimate goal of increasing efficiency, productivity and communication.
  • Represent AET by presenting ideas, solutions, and innovative advancements to clients, peer groups, public audiences, and regulatory agencies and in professional publications.
  • Ability to anticipate, recognize, and manage risk/liability.
  • Ability to be forward-thinking with respect to technologies, practices, policies, and other areas in order to promote and advance the company.
  • Thorough understanding of project contracts and commitments to be satisfied by AET’s work scope.
